Whirlpool has implemented an Operational Excellence (OpEx) program for over 13 years to drive customer focus, innovation, and lean manufacturing. The program began in the US in 1996 and expanded to Europe in 2003. It focuses on training engineers using tools like Design of Experiments and the Plan-Do-Study-Act cycle within projects rather than standalone Six Sigma projects. This embedded approach and a focus on practical training has led to a culture change where data drives engineering decisions. The program has achieved a return on investment of over 10 to 1 and is now self-sustaining due to its success.

What is it?
Corporate Social Responsibility Innovation (CSR-I) is an innovation training service that empowers
organizations in identifying innovation opportunities while assisting new immigrants (Internationally-
Trained Professionals, ITPs) obtain their first professional Canadian job experience.
Background
Innovation is a multidisciplinary exercise that can be taught and systematically executed. Envisioning
Labs has trained dozens of organizations in proven innovation methodologies that have allow them
to exploit opportunities for growth and innovate, thus creating new value-added products, services or
experiences for their clients.
CSR-I relies on the unique value that only Internationally-Trained Professionals (ITPs) can bring to the
innovation exercise. ITPs are normally professionals with undergraduate and graduate degrees
coupled with 6+ years of working experience (normally 10+ years). However, due to lack of “Canadian
experience” these professionals remain underemployed for as long as 5 years after arriving to the
country. We have proven that this talent pool of qualified individuals is a remarkable innovation asset
to corporations if we direct their expertise, potential and international experience through our
systematic training.

FAQ
CORPORATE CLIENTS
How much does this training cost?
Contact us to determine professional fees.
How could this program be part of our social responsibility budget?
There is a direct investment into a social cause that is pervasive across 45% percent of the population
of new Canadians. The vast majority of immigrants are highly qualified professionals that are not
landing a job because they lack “Canadian job experience”. Your organization will be boosting their
employability and therefore making a positive impact into the overall job marketplace.
What type of “innovation” projects are suitable for this program?
Non-critical projects are ideal for this program, that is, projects that belong to the ‘wish list’ of the
organization where there hasn’t been time, resources or commitment to explore these options further.
Some example of projects that ITPs had worked on in the past include: improving the front desk
customer service experience, fostering diversity dialogue and learning transfer and streamlining
internal training for employees. These projects are normally complex in nature and benefit from a
multidisciplinary approach to provide ‘out of the box’ solutions.
How do we select these ‘innovation’ projects?
Our consultants work with clients to scope the innovation project one or two weeks prior to the start
of the training.
Are my employees required to work full time on this training?
Yes, this is an intense hands-on workshop/training that requires participant employees (up to 2) to be
fully engaged for six days. The upside of course is that they are laser-focused on exploring additional
value-added options for the company.
What about intellectual property (IP) and sensitive information?
All IP generated is owned by the client. If the project entails dealing with sensitive information, all ITPs
and Envisioning Labs consultants shall sign a Non-Disclosure Agreement.
Who are these ITPs (Internationally-Trained Professionals)?
ITPs are new immigrants from around the world with undergraduate and graduate degrees coupled
with 6+ years of working experience (normally 10+ years). Candidates considered for this program
are pre-selected by our program partners: ISS of BC and MOSAIC.
Where can I see testimonials of past projects?
We have some video testimonials of people who participated in our program in our YouTube channel:
http://www.youtube.com/envisioninglabs

FAQ
PARTICIPANTS
(Internationally-Trained Professionals, ITPs)
How much does this training cost?
Nothing for ITPs.
Do I get compensated for my work designing a solution?
Yes. We pay ITPs $500 to $600 per project, depending on the company we work for. Bear in mind that
while this is a *paid* training in innovation techniques to boost your employability, you will still be
required to deliver professional results. The ultimately goal of the program is for you to get your first
professional Canadian job experience (and hopefully a good reference letter as well).
So, I will be designing a solution while I’m learning a new innovation methodology?
Yes. This is a hands-on workshop that teaches how to find innovation opportunities and along the
way building a proof of concept of a new product or service. You get to work side by side with
company’s employees as an innovation team providing fresh perspectives to some of the company’s
problems.
Do I need to be qualified in any particular area?
No. The innovation methodology we teach thrives on having multidisciplinary professionals as they
contribute their own individual ideas and perspectives (based on your professional expertise and
international experience). The basic qualifications we seek in candidates for this program are: a
university degree, a minimum English level of 7 based on the Canadian Language Benchmarks (CLB),
and at least 6 years of professional experience.
What about any intellectual property that we create during the project?
All intellectual property generated during this program belongs to the company.
Do I need to sign a Non-Disclosure Agreement?
Very likely, however it will ultimately depend on the company we work for.
